现在APP开发的主流工具是什么?

作者:亿网科技  来源:亿网科技  发布时间:2024-04-23

软件开发 – 2.png

随着移动互联网的蓬勃发展,APP(应用程序)开发已成为一个重要且热门的领域。开发者不断寻找更加高效、便捷、强大的工具来简化开发流程,提高开发效率。本文将介绍目前应用开发的主流工具,帮助开发者选择适合自己的工具。

1.颤动

Flutter是Google推出的开源移动应用开发框架,可以快速构建高质量、跨平台的APP。Flutter使用Dart编程语言,具有独特的UI设计风格,称为“Flutter风格”,可以实现美观且高性能的用户界面。Flutter提供了丰富的组件库、强大的性能和快速的开发周期,因此在跨平台APP开发中非常受欢迎。

2.反应本机

ReactNative是Facebook开源的JavaScript框架,可用于开发本机移动应用程序。它允许开发人员使用JavaScript和React编写应用程序,同时生成与本机应用程序相同的用户界面。ReactNative具有很强的可移植性和跨平台性,可以在iOS和Android平台上构建高效、流畅的应用程序。这使得ReactNative成为许多开发人员的首选工具。

3.科特林

Kotlin是一种现代静态类型编程语言,可与Java互操作,广泛用于Android应用程序开发。Kotlin简洁、安全、富有表现力,可以减少代码量和开发周期。谷歌宣布将正式支持Kotlin作为Android开发的一级语言,这进一步推动了Kotlin在APP开发中的应用。

4.Xcode

对于iOS应用程序开发,Xcode是主流的集成开发环境(IDE)。Xcode提供了开发、测试和调试iOS应用程序所需的所有工具,包括代码编辑器、界面设计工具、模拟器和调试器等,它还集成了Apple的开发工具和框架,使开发人员能够构建美观、高性能的iOS应用程序。

5.Android工作室

AndroidStudio是官方推荐的Android应用程序开发IDE。它基于JetBrains的IntelliJIDEA,提供丰富的开发工具和功能,包括代码编辑器、布局设计器、调试工具和模拟器。AndroidStudio与Android开发套件(SDK)紧密集成,为开发者提供了便捷的开发环境和丰富的资源。

除了上述主流工具之外,还有很多其他辅助工具和框架,例如Ionic、NativeScript、Cordova等,它们都提供了便捷的开发方式和跨平台能力。

综上所述,目前APP开发的主流工具包括Flutter、ReactNative、Kotlin、Xcode和AndroidStudio等,开发者可以根据自己的需求和技术偏好选择适合自己的工具,以提高开发效率、简化开发流程,并构建高质量的移动应用程序。